
Pellowe Reef is an intermediate dive site on the outer Great Barrier Reef near Cairns. Reaching 30 meters depth, this reef features a spectacular underwater landscape of coral pinnacles, walls, and swim-throughs. The reef is known for its pristine coral coverage and diverse marine ecosystem. Divers regularly encounter sea turtles, reef sharks, Maori wrasse, and vast schools of fusiliers. The outer reef location provides consistently excellent visibility and vibrant coral colors.
